| import os |
| import pwd |
| import re |
| import platform |
| import socket |
| import crm_script |
| |
| PACKAGES = ['booth', 'cluster-glue', 'corosync', 'crmsh', 'csync2', 'drbd', |
| 'fence-agents', 'gfs2', 'gfs2-utils', 'hawk', 'ocfs2', |
| 'ocfs2-tools', 'pacemaker', 'pacemaker-mgmt', |
| 'resource-agents', 'sbd'] |
| SERVICES = ['sshd', 'ntp', 'corosync', 'pacemaker', 'hawk', 'SuSEfirewall2_init'] |
| SSH_KEY = os.path.expanduser('~/.ssh/id_rsa') |
| CSYNC2_KEY = '/etc/csync2/key_hagroup' |
| CSYNC2_CFG = '/etc/csync2/csync2.cfg' |
| COROSYNC_CONF = '/etc/corosync/corosync.conf' |
| SYSCONFIG_SBD = '/etc/sysconfig/sbd' |
| SYSCONFIG_FW = '/etc/sysconfig/SuSEfirewall2' |
| SYSCONFIG_FW_CLUSTER = '/etc/sysconfig/SuSEfirewall2.d/services/cluster' |
| |
| |
| def rpm_info(): |
| 'check installed packages' |
| return crm_script.rpmcheck(PACKAGES) |
| |
| |
| def service_info(service): |
| "Returns information about a given service" |
| active, enabled = 'unknown', 'unknown' |
| rc, out, err = crm_script.call(["/usr/bin/systemctl", "is-enabled", "%s.service" % (service)]) |
| if rc in (0, 1, 3) and out: |
| enabled = out.strip() |
| else: |
| return {'name': service, 'error': err.strip()} |
| rc, out, err = crm_script.call(["/usr/bin/systemctl", "is-active", "%s.service" % (service)]) |
| if rc in (0, 1, 3) and out: |
| active = out.strip() |
| else: |
| return {'name': service, 'error': err.strip()} |
| return {'name': service, 'active': active, 'enabled': enabled} |
| |
| |
| def services_info(): |
| 'check enabled/active services' |
| return [service_info(service) for service in SERVICES] |

| def verify(data): |
| """ |
| Given output from info(), verifies |
| as much as possible before init/add. |
| """ |
| def check_diskspace(): |
| for host, info in data.iteritems(): |
| for mount, percent in info['disk']: |
| interesting = (mount == '/' or |
| mount.startswith('/var/log') or |
| mount.startswith('/tmp')) |
| if interesting and percent > 90: |
| crm_script.exit_fail("Not enough space on %s:%s" % (host, mount)) |
| |
| def check_services(): |
| for host, info in data.iteritems(): |
| for svc in info['services']: |
| if svc['name'] == 'pacemaker' and svc['active'] == 'active': |
| crm_script.exit_fail("%s already running pacemaker" % (host)) |
| if svc['name'] == 'corosync' and svc['active'] == 'active': |
| crm_script.exit_fail("%s already running corosync" % (host)) |
| |
| def verify_host(host, info): |
| if host != info['system']['hostname']: |
| crm_script.exit_fail("Hostname mismatch: %s is not %s" % |
| (host, info['system']['hostname'])) |
| |
| def compare_system(systems): |
| def check(value, msg): |
| vals = set([system[value] for host, system in systems]) |
| if len(vals) > 1: |
| info = ', '.join('%s: %s' % (h, system[value]) for h, system in systems) |
| crm_script.exit_fail("%s: %s" % (msg, info)) |
| |
| check('machine', 'Architecture differs') |
| #check('release', 'Kernel release differs') |
| check('distname', 'Distribution differs') |
| check('distver', 'Distribution version differs') |
| #check('version', 'Kernel version differs') |
| |
| for host, info in data.iteritems(): |
| verify_host(host, info) |
| |
| compare_system((h, info['system']) for h, info in data.iteritems()) |
| |
| check_diskspace() |
| check_services() |

| def configure_firewall(): |
| _SUSE_FW_TEMPLATE = """## Name: HAE cluster ports |
| ## Description: opens ports for HAE cluster services |
| TCP="%(tcp)s" |
| UDP="%(udp)s" |
| """ |
| corosync_mcastport = crm_script.param('mcastport') |
| if not corosync_mcastport: |
| rc, out, err = crm_script.call(['crm', 'corosync', 'get', 'totem.interface.mcastport']) |
| if rc == 0: |
| corosync_mcastport = out.strip() |
| FW = '/etc/sysconfig/SuSEfirewall2' |
| FW_CLUSTER = '/etc/sysconfig/SuSEfirewall2.d/services/cluster' |
| |
| tcp_ports = '30865 5560 7630 21064' |
| udp_ports = '%s %s' % (corosync_mcastport, int(corosync_mcastport) - 1) |
| |
| if is_service_enabled('SuSEfirewall2'): |
| if os.path.isfile(FW_CLUSTER): |
| tmpl = open(FW_CLUSTER).read() |
| tmpl = re.sub(r'^TCP="(.*)"', 'TCP="%s"' % (tcp_ports), tmpl, flags=re.M) |
| tmpl = re.sub(r'^UDP="(.*)"', 'UDP="%s"' % (udp_ports), tmpl, flags=re.M) |
| with open(FW_CLUSTER, 'w') as f: |
| f.write(tmpl) |
| elif os.path.isdir(os.path.dirname(FW_CLUSTER)): |
| with open(FW_CLUSTER, 'w') as fwc: |
| fwc.write(_SUSE_FW_TEMPLATE % {'tcp': tcp_ports, |
| 'udp': udp_ports}) |
| else: |
| # neither the cluster file nor the services |
| # directory exists |
| crm_script.exit_fail("SUSE firewall is configured but %s does not exist" % |
| os.path.dirname(FW_CLUSTER)) |
| |
| # add cluster to FW_CONFIGURATIONS_EXT |
| if os.path.isfile(FW): |
| txt = open(FW).read() |
| m = re.search(r'^FW_CONFIGURATIONS_EXT="(.*)"', txt, re.M) |
| if m: |
| services = m.group(1).split() |
| if 'cluster' not in services: |
| services.append('cluster') |
| txt = re.sub(r'^FW_CONFIGURATIONS_EXT="(.*)"', |
| r'FW_CONFIGURATIONS_EXT="%s"' % (' '.join(services)), |
| txt, |
| flags=re.M) |
| else: |
| txt += '\nFW_CONFIGURATIONS_EXT="cluster"' |
| with open(FW, 'w') as fw: |
| fw.write(txt) |
| if is_service_active('SuSEfirewall2'): |
| crm_script.service('SuSEfirewall2', 'restart') |
